                      What you really need for a box of fresh pencils is first rate manual sharpener–-now that's exciting, think of all the time you can spend just getting the points right? Life is good, no?  This one below is from Muji---a fine purveyor things Japanese, of course.  But for the finer work a Higo no Kami Tokudai Nagaokoma, or small folding pen knife, or if you like something a bit smaller, a Saikai Higonokami.  Look here for some examples: https://improb.com/best-japanese-edc-knives/  Well-spent time sharpening pencils. 

                      Here's the saikai higonokami.  Who wouldn't love this in your IH pocket?

                                            Pencils & associated tools, large acid-free sketchbook, and technical pens purchased Sunday. Spending some time off the grid and I figured reading and seeing if I can remember how to draw would be fun indoor pursuits, with backcountry exploration dominating our outdoor pursuits.

                                            May need to buy another copy of "Drawing On the Right Side of the Brain."

                                            First project is to capture Otis well enough that I could frame a sketch. Then I can do one of his sister when she arrives. I'd like to be able to do these in ink but need a lot of practice. I would love to be able to pull off a sumi-e brushed ink portrait but I'm even rustier on that medium. It feels good to draw again. I never had the discipline to get very good at it, but I should be able to get good enough to have fun as a personal hobby.
